Front grille badge

Actually you don't need to remove the grille at all to remove the VW badge.

Just simply turn the badge from the outside counter clockwise to about a 10pm position and it removes this is how it was designed.

Obviously refit is the reverse

It's incredibly easy to remove the grilles. I just did it this weekend.

Upper grille: Remove two torx screws at top corners. Near top center there are two clips, push them and it lifts right out.

Fog grilles: Pull. They just snap out.

On my Rabbit with no fog lights, the passenger side fog grille has a screw in it, right in the center, directly visible. Why would they stick a screw dead center right in the face of it?

Lower main grille: According to my searches here, it just snaps out like the fog grille.
